HAL® S315.100 is an easy-to-use and portable airway management and CPR skills trainer. HAL was designed to help you teach basic and advanced airway management as well as cardiopulmonary resuscitation. HAL helps participants learn to recognize laryngospasm and practice performing emergency tracheostomies and cricothyrotomies. HAL® is available in a full-body configuration.

Product Features
General
Manually open or close eyes
Normal, miosis (constricted), and mydriasis (blown) pupil states
Independent left/right pupil states simulate consensual and nonconsensual response
Realistic head tilt/chin lift and jaw thrust
Durable, lifelike airway anatomy
Nasal and oral intubation: ETT, LMA, King LT
Laryngospasms
Supports tracheostomies and cricothyrotomies
Palpable carotid pulse
Visible chest rise with bag-valve-mask ventilation
Gastric distension with esophageal intubation
Right mainstem intubation presents unilateral chest rise
CPR hand positioning landmarks
Realistic chest compression recoil and depth
